Novel corrosion-resistant behavior and mechanism of a biomimetic surface with switchable wettability on Mg alloy

Dongsong Wei et al.

Summary: A switchable surface between superhydrophobic surface (SHS) and slippery liquid-infused porous surface (SLIPS) has been designed on magnesium alloy to improve corrosion resistance and provide different water-repellent properties. The surface can be easily switched between SHS and SLIPS by alcohol washing and lubricant-infusion, exhibiting excellent anti-corrosion ability and promising a wide range of application prospects in metals such as anti-icing, drag reduction, and anti-fouling.

Reversible wettability switching of piezo-responsive nanostructured polymer fibers by electric field

Hazem Idriss et al.

Summary: This work describes the preparation of fibers array with electric field switchable wettability using the piezoelectric properties of PVDF and the chemical reactivity of PMMA. It was found that by varying the orientation of the electric field and using different substrates with different conductivity, the shape of the deionized water drop can be controlled effectively. Additionally, the polarity of water can be shifted by dissolving NaCl salt in different concentrations.
